FPL partners with the Florida National Parks Association, donates $10,000 to Keep Biscayne Beautiful

Florida Power & Light Company (FPL) has partnered with and donated $10,000 to the Florida National Parks Association, Inc., to support Keep Biscayne Beautiful, a new campaign to unite individuals and organizations to raise awareness and take action to promote the health and enjoyment of Biscayne Bay and its surrounding areas.

Keep Biscayne Beautiful’s initiatives are focused on three main objectives: marine education, marine stewardship, and marine recreation.

“Biscayne Bay is a highly valued recreational and environmentally rich resource in South Florida,” said Michael Sole, vice president, environmental services, FPL. “At FPL, we believe in supporting organizations and causes that make South Florida a better place to live, work and play.  Biscayne Bay is one of those special places that defines what it means to live in South Florida and a critical step to ensuring that it is viable for future generations is keeping it healthy and educating the public about doing so.”

The donation from FPL will help fund Biscayne Bay area water and beach clean ups which have, over the past 10 years, removed over 144 tons of marine debris. This includes covering the costs of boats to transport volunteers who work under the supervision of Biscayne National Park representatives to remove marine waste from this treasured South Florida ecosystem.

Keep Biscayne Beautiful is an exciting new campaign that supports important projects such as beach and marine debris cleanups, restoration of the iconic Boca Chita lighthouse, youth educational and fishing programs, additional marine patrols and expanding mooring buoys to protect coral.
